A » Direct dyes are water-soluble anionic dyes that adhere to cellulose fibers through hydrogen bonding and Van der Waals forces. These dyes are applied in a neutral or slightly alkaline bath, often with added electrolytes like sodium chloride, to enhance dye uptake. The process is straightforward, allowing for easy application on cotton, paper, and leather, providing vibrant colors with reasonable wash fastness in an economical and efficient manner.
